An analysis is presented of the effect of the terminator on the electric field and field-aligned currents in the polar-cap ionosphere. Plasma convection lines are found to stretch jointly to the morning sector and to undergo a discontinuity at the terminator. When Hall and Pedersen conductivities are equal, the convection lines approach the terminator at an angle of 45 deg. If there is a uniform electric field within the polar cap, there should arise an additional system of field-aligned currents, flowing onto the terminator within the polar cap and flowing out of the ionosphere at the daytime boundary of the polar cap. In addition, a potential difference should arise between the equator and the pole.
